thinkharderdev commented on issue #5345:
URL: https://github.com/apache/arrow-rs/issues/5345#issuecomment-2049489784

   Coming back to this. I agree that maybe exposing HTTP status codes breaks 
the abstraction, but I think the more basic issue is that we don't expose 
`PermissionDenied` errors in a way that is easy to determine in client code. It 
seems like this should be a first-class error variant? All object stores that 
are supported have some notion of permissions. 


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]

Reply via email to